What Are Lighting Upgrades?
Lighting upgrades refer to the service of replacing existing electrical lighting components with newer solutions. This can include transitioning from incandescent or fluorescent bulbs to LED technology, adding programmable controls, replacing electrical infrastructure to accommodate updated fixtures, and redesigning placement for improved illumination.
From a technical standpoint, a lighting upgrade begins with an assessment of your existing electrical system. Your electrician verifies that wiring can safely support the load of new fixtures. Old wiring that proves outdated gets replaced or reinforced before updated fixtures are installed. Accurate mounting hardware guarantees that each light sits securely and performs reliably.
Outside of just hardware, lighting upgrades frequently include the operational aspect of your setup. Examples include installing motion-activated switches, connecting smart home systems, and configuring scheduling systems. Together, these features work together to cut energy use and offer you more precise management of your home's lighting.
Top Advantages Lighting Upgrades
- Significant Energy Savings: Modern LED fixtures use significantly less power than outdated fluorescent bulbs, cutting your monthly bills right away.
- Fewer Replacements Over Time: Quality upgraded fixtures often runs tens of thousands of hours compared to older technology, translating to less maintenance over time.
- Healthier Illumination: Modern lighting delivers consistent brightness without inconsistent output, helping reduce headaches for everyone in the building.
- Increased Home Resale Appeal: Buyers and renters consistently notice quality lighting when evaluating a property, which makes the investment financially worthwhile for resale.
- Enhanced Security Lighting: Strategically positioned lighting minimizes dark spots in parking areas and around the property, improving visibility day and night.
- Smart Home Integration: Updated fixtures and wiring make it possible for smart switches that allow you to adjust your lights from anywhere.
- Cooler Operating Temperatures: In contrast with traditional bulbs, LED fixtures generate significantly less warmth, resulting in lower cooling costs during summer months.
- Greener Electrical Footprint: Using less energy results in a smaller environmental footprint, which makes lighting upgrades a sustainable choice for property owners across the board.

Lighting Upgrades Frequently Asked Questions
How long does a lighting upgrade take to complete?
The majority of home lighting upgrade jobs run about four and eight hours depending on how many fixtures are involved. Bigger multi-room jobs may span multiple days. Our team will provide a realistic time estimate during the project planning phase.
How much should I budget for lighting upgrades?
The investment differs widely depending on project scope. One room's worth of LED fixture swap may start around $150 to $300, while a whole-home lighting upgrade often falls between $1,500 to $5,000 or more. We delivers transparent, line-item estimates before a single fixture is touched.
Is a lighting upgrade disruptive to my daily routine?
The majority of installation is relatively non-invasive for the people using the space. Electricity in specific areas is temporarily interrupted during the work, but remaining circuits usually remain powered on. Our team works efficiently to reduce interruptions.
What is the lifespan of upgraded LED fixtures?
Quality LED fixtures added as part of a lighting upgrade can last upwards of 50,000 hours under regular daily operation. In practical terms most homeowners won't need to replace bulbs or fixtures for well over a decade after the initial installation.
Is a phased lighting upgrade possible?
Absolutely — many homeowners choose to complete lighting upgrades in stages to fit their budget. We can prioritize the most urgent rooms first, making sure you get the strongest results from the early investment.
